How Joint Sizes and Genders Work (The Basics)
To get the best results from the Dab Rig Compatibility Checker, it helps to understand the vocabulary of glass joints. There are two main factors: Gender and Size.
1. Joint Gender
- Male Joints: These have the glass tapering outward. You need an accessory that slides over the top of it. Therefore, a male rig requires a female banger.
- Female Joints: These have an opening that goes inward. You need an accessory that slides inside of it. A female rig requires a male banger.
2. Joint Size Chart
Industry standards in glass blowing have given us three main sizes. Here is a quick reference table to help you identify what you have:
| Joint Size | Common Use Case | Airflow Profile |
| 10mm (Micro) | Mini rigs, nectar collectors, and travel pieces. | Highly restricted airflow, excellent for preserving intense flavor. |
| 14mm (Standard) | The most common size for daily-driver dab rigs and medium water pipes. | The perfect balance of airflow and flavor. The industry standard. |
| 18mm (Oversized) | Large bongs and heavy-duty flower pieces converted for dabs. | Massive airflow, best for taking very large, deep draws. |

How to Measure Your Dab Rig Joint
If you don’t know your size to put into the Dab Rig Compatibility Checker, you can find out with a very simple trick using everyday items!
- The Pen Trick (10mm): A standard ballpoint pen tip will barely fit into a 10mm female joint. If the hole is very small, it’s a 10mm.
- The Pinky Trick (14mm): If the tip of your pinky finger fits snugly into the joint, it is almost certainly a 14mm.
- The Dime Trick (18mm): A US dime will perfectly cover the opening of an 18mm joint. If the hole is that wide, you have an 18mm!

2. Can I connect a male banger to a male rig?
Not directly. You will need a female-to-female glass adapter. You can input your current setup into the Dab Rig Compatibility Checker to find the exact adapter size you need to bridge the gap!
3. Does joint angle matter?
Yes! Rigs usually have either a 90-degree angle (pointing straight up) or a 45-degree angle (tilted). Make sure you match the angle so your banger sits perfectly flat; otherwise, your concentrates will pool on one side.
4. What is the most common size found on the Dab Rig Compatibility Checker?
The 14mm male banger going into a 14mm female rig is currently the most popular and widely available setup in the industry.
5. Will my carb cap fit any banger?
No. Carb caps are measured by their diameter, not the joint size. Once the Dab Rig Compatibility Checker helps you find your banger, you will need to look at the outer diameter (usually 20mm, 25mm, or 30mm) of the banger bucket to find a matching cap.
